Right-Sizing and Increasing Efficiency

Right-sizing involves matching your cloud resources to the actual usage. By monitoring your cloud usage and adjusting it accordingly, you can avoid paying for idle or underused resources.

For instance, Amazon Web Services (AWS) offers AWS Trusted Advisor, a tool that provides real-time insights to help right-size your cloud resources. By leveraging such tools, businesses can maximize their cloud ROI.

Adopting a Multi-Cloud Strategy

More companies are embracing a multi-cloud strategy to optimize costs. A study by Gartner revealed that 81% of public cloud users work with two or more providers. By distributing workloads across multiple cloud providers, companies can leverage the best pricing models and services from each, ultimately reducing costs.

Leveraging Reserved Instances and Savings Plans

Cloud providers like AWS, Google Cloud, and Azure offer options to reserve instances or subscribe to savings plans. By committing to a long-term contract, businesses can enjoy significant discounts.

Harnessing Open-source Tools for Cloud Cost Optimization

Open-source tools can also play a crucial role in cloud cost optimization. Tools like Cloud Custodian, an open-source project backed by Capital One, can help automate cloud management tasks, including cost optimization.
